The Body Doesn't Heal Without Sleep
When we sleep, our bodies enter into fixing setting. Muscles recover, cells regenerate, and our immune system enhances. It's a time when the body detoxes and recovers. Yet when rest is cut short or when it's regularly low quality, this entire process is disrupted.
In time, a lack of proper rest can lead to damaged resistance, making you a lot more prone to ailments. Also wounds heal more slowly when you're sleep-deprived. Persistent bad sleep has also been connected to a greater risk of developing long-term wellness problems like c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and high blood pressure.
A good night's remainder isn't a high-end-- it's a necessity for the body to operate effectively.

Psychological Resilience Depends on Quality Rest
Ever observe how your patience wears thin after a negative night's sleep? That's no coincidence. Rest and feelings are deeply intertwined.
When you're well-rested, you're much better equipped to control your feelings and respond to stressful circumstances. Without rest, small troubles can really feel frustrating. This happens since the mind's psychological facility becomes overactive, while the region in charge of abstract thought reduces.
State of mind swings, irritability, stress and anxiety, and even depressive episodes can all be linked to bad sleep. Psychological security relies upon obtaining regular, deep remainder. And if disrupted rest becomes a pattern, it may be time to explore if a deeper concern goes to play.

Hormone Imbalance and Weight Gain
Yes, rest affects your weight-- and not even if you're also tired to hit the health club.
Sleep plays a major function in managing the hormonal agents that control appetite and metabolic rate. When you're sleep-deprived, your body produces more ghrelin (the appetite hormonal agent) and much less leptin (the hormonal agent that makes you really feel full). This imbalance commonly brings about increased hunger and unhealthy food options.
Furthermore, persistent inadequate sleep can disrupt insulin sensitivity, boosting the danger of kind 2 diabetes mellitus. Your body's capacity to manage blood sugar level counts greatly on rest, making it necessary for total metabolic wellness.
